PHOTOS: 'Longest ever' ship enters Taw and Torridge Estuary North Devon Gazette She measured just under 120 metres - most ships entering the estuary measure 90 metres - and was the longest ever to enter the estuary, according to Bideford harbour master Roger Hoad.
